About 620 Mantooth Loop

How much is 620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M worth?

The TopHap Estimate for 620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M is $55,000 as of Jul 14, 2026. The likely range is $50,805 to $59,195. The estimate is modelled from recorded sales, assessments and the property's own characteristics — it is not an appraisal.

When did 620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M last sell?

620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M last sold on Sep 12, 2018, according to the county's recorded deed.

How big is 620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M?

620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M has 5 bedrooms, 2 bathrooms, 1,966 square feet of living space and a 0.43-acre lot.

When was 620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M built?

620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M was built in 1935, making it 91 years old. It is a conventional home. The building has 1 story.

What schools serve 620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M?

620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M is assigned to Hatch Valley Middle School (middle), rated D; Hatch Valley Elementary School (elementary), rated A; Hatch Valley High School (high), rated D+. All sit in Hatch Valley Municipal Schools. Attendance boundaries change — confirm with the district before relying on an assignment.

How does 620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M compare to other homes in Rincon 87940?

Among the 109 homes in Rincon 87940, it is worth more than 2% of them ($55,000 against a typical $131,936), its price per square foot is higher than 4% of them ($28 against a typical $76), it is bigger than 66% of them (1,966 ft² against a typical 1,536 ft²), its lot is bigger than 46% of them (0.43 ac against a typical 0.48 ac) and it is newer than 30% of them (1935 against a typical 1970). Measured against all of Dona Ana County, it is worth more than almost no homes there. These shares are recounted nightly from the full county assessor record for each area, not from active listings.

What are the property taxes on 620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M?

The 2025 property tax bill for 620 Mantooth Loop, Rincon, NM was $387. The county assessed it at $14,160.
